Tuscan Chicken Pasta Bake Recipe

  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: 4 1x

Ingredients

Main Ingredients:

  • 12 ounces (340 grams) penne pasta
  • 2 cups cooked shredded chicken
  • 2 cups fresh spinach
  • 1 cup sun-dried tomatoes, chopped

Cheese:

  • 1.5 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 0.5 cup grated Parmesan cheese

Seasonings and Additional Ingredients:

  • 2 cups heavy cream
  • 4 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• Salt to taste
  • P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Warm the oven to 375°F, preparing a welcoming environment for the pasta bake.
  2. Prepare the pasta according to package guidelines, ensuring a perfect al dente texture, then drain and reserve.
  3. Infuse olive oil with minced garlic in a skillet, releasing aromatic flavors over medium heat.
  4. Create a luxurious sauce by introducing heavy cream,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per, allowing it to simmer and develop depth for 3-4 minutes.
  5. Incorporate mozzarella and Parmesan cheeses into the sauce, stirring until they melt into a velvety, smooth consistency.
  6. Combine the cooked pasta with tender chicken, vibrant spinach, and tangy sun-dried tomatoes, gently coating everything in the rich, creamy sauce.
  7. Transfer the harmonious mixture to a greased baking dish, generously scattering additional mozzarella across the top for a golden, crispy finish.
  8. Bake for 20-25 minutes until the surface turns golden and the edges bubble with excitement.
  9. Allow the dish to rest for 5 minutes, letting the flavors meld and settle before serving this comforting Tuscan-inspired creation.

Notes

  • Boost protein by adding grilled shrimp or tofu for a versatile protein swap that keeps the dish exciting and adaptable.
  • Create a lighter version using Greek yogurt instead of heavy cream, reducing calories while maintaining creamy texture and tangy flavor.
  • Gluten-free option works perfectly by substituting regular penne with gluten-free pasta, ensuring everyone can enjoy this delicious comfort meal without compromise.
  • Prep ingredients ahead of time to make weeknight cooking a breeze, chopping chicken and vegetables in advance for quick assembly and minimal kitchen stress.
  • Prep Time: 20 minutes
  • Cook Time: 25 minutes
  • Category: Lunch, Dinner
  • Method: Baking
  • Cuisine: Italian
